Order Picker
Mon to Fri 8am - 4.30pm
Acheson, must have reliable transportation
$20-22/ hour
Do you thrive in a busy distribution-based environment? If you answered yes to these questions, I urge you to read on to learn more about the role!
...
We have a job opening in Acheson that needs to be filled immediately and are looking for an equipment operator with extensive experience in operating various machines in a warehouse setting. The candidate should have excellent material handling skills, a professional demeanor, and a strong focus on safety. While the role involves operating equipment, it also requires significant manual lifting of heavy objects. If you're someone who wants to combine your workout routine with work, this position could be an ideal fit for you.
Advantages
-Weekly pay and potential long term permanent opportunity
-Wages of $21 hour
-Day shift 8am - 4.30pm
-Benefits available after first pay
Responsibilities
-Working independently as well as with others depending on the assigned task
-Accurate order picking and products put away
-Working in a fast-paced environment
-Consistent communication with teammates and supervisors
-Consistent manual lifting up to 50lbs
-Standing, Bending, Walking for up to 8 hours a shift
Qualifications
- 2+ years experience in a warehouse or order picking setting
- Shipping/receiving experience is an asset
- An external forklift ticket (Asset)
- Reliable transportation is a must, locations are not accessible by public transit
- Must be able to complete a Background check and a reference check
